Job Purpose

The Patient Ambassador will play a crucial role in ensuring a positive and comforting experience for patients and their families within a healthcare setting. The Patient Ambassador will provide patient services and administrative support in ancillary operations. The Patient Ambassador will interact with patients, physicians, and other staff under moderate supervision in a courteous manner. Assist other employees within their department as well as other departments. Collect and verify demographic information to ensure accuracy. May be responsible for scheduling patients for ancillary appointments. The position may require floating to ancillary patient areas for coverage. The next step on the Med-Metrix career ladder is a Patient Access Representative.

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Proactively approach and greet visitors while maintaining an atmosphere of warmth, personal interest, and positive concern
  • Complete computer-aided registration with patients professionally and courteously
  • Collect accurate demographic and insurance information. Update systems as needed to ensure accurate registration in accordance with department standards.
  • Act as a liaison between patients, staff, volunteers, visitors, and the hospital
  • Gather feedback from patients and their families regarding their experiences and care
  • Communicate hospital policy and procedure to patients, visitors, and staff with respect and consideration
  • Anticipates and responds to patients' needs, following up until their needs are met
  • Respond to patient portal work lists and / or work queues
  • Patient Ambassadors are required to move extensively around the work area
  • Speak up when team members appear to exhibit unsafe behavior or performance
  • Continuously validate and verify information needed for decision making or documentation
  • Stop in the face of uncertainty and take time to resolve the situation
  • Demonstrate accurate, clear, and timely verbal and written communication
  • Actively promote safety for patients, families, visitors, and coworkers
  • Attend carefully to important details, practicing the STAR method – Stop, Think, Act, and Review- to self-check behavior and performance
  • Maintain a clean and organized environment at the welcome desk and kiosks
  • Keep individuals and registration kiosks organized to prevent crowding
  • Maintain office supplies, equipment, and reference materials
  • All Ambassadors are responsible for the information distributed via e-mail.  Staff should check work email a minimum of three times daily and respond to inquiries within 24 hours (or the next business day)

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or equivalent is required
  • 1 year of experience in healthcare or 2 years of comparable experience in customer service
  • Ability to speak Spanish is desired
  • Broad knowledge of administrative processes and / or customer service skills
  • Basic computer knowledge
  • Must possess the ability to resolve problems and respond to complaints positively and productively
  • Must be able to work amid constant distraction and deal courteously and effectively with several requests simultaneously
  • Complete Patient Access training curriculum and pass all competency assessments
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ite
  • Strong interpersonal skills, ability to communicate well at all levels of the organization
  • Strong problem solving and creative skills and the ability to exercise sound judgment and make decisions based on accurate and timely analyses
  • High level of integrity and dependability with a strong sense of urgency and results oriented
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ills required
  • Gracious and welcoming personality for customer service interaction
